Subject: [PATCH 03/20] drm/i915/gemfs: enable THP

Enable transparent-huge-pages through gemfs by mounting with
huge=within_size.

drivers/gpu/drm/i915/i915_gemfs.c | 15 +++++++++++++++
1 file changed, 15 insertions(+)
diff --git a/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/i915_gemfs.c b/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/i915_gemfs.c
index 168d0bd98f60..999f0b6a2d64 100644
--- a/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/i915_gemfs.c
+++ b/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/i915_gemfs.c
@@ -24,6 +24,7 @@
#include <linux/fs.h>
#include <linux/mount.h>
+#include <linux/pagemap.h>
#include "i915_drv.h"
#include "i915_gemfs.h"
@@ -41,6 +42,20 @@ int i915_gemfs_init(struct drm_i915_private *i915)
if (IS_ERR(gemfs))
return PTR_ERR(gemfs);
+ if (has_transparent_hugepage()) {
+ struct super_block *sb = gemfs->mnt_sb;
+ char options[] = "huge=within_size";
+ int flags = 0;
+
+ /* We don't consider failure to remount fatal, since this should
+ * only ever attempt to modify the mount options of the sb, and
+ * so should always leave us with a working mount upon failure.
+ * Hence decoupling this from the actual kern_mount is probably
+ * advisable.
+ */
+ WARN_ON(sb->s_op->remount_fs(sb, &flags, options));
+ }
+
i915->mm.gemfs = gemfs;
return 0;
